Abstract

By introducing the concepts of characteristic rate curves and rate curve decomposition, a novel framework for rate-distortion (R-D) analysis and source modeling is developed in this work. With this framework, a fast algorithm is then proposed to accurately estimate the R- D curve of wavelet-based image coders. The proposed algorithm is applied to the SPIHT (Set Partitioning In Hierarchical Trees)1 and Stact-Run (SR) encoders2. Our extensive experimental results show that the relative R-D curve estimation error is less than 5%.
